Abstract

The invention discloses a wild-imitating planting method of dendrobium officinale, which comprises the following steps: s-1, obtaining dendrobium seedlings; s-2, domestication of dendrobium seedlings: removing the dendrobium seedlings from the tissue culture medium, cleaning the culture medium, planting the dendrobium seedlings in a domestication substrate, domesticating for 12-15 days under domestication conditions, wherein the domestication conditions are a cycle of 25-30 ℃ for 10h and 42-45 ℃ for 4 h; s-3, treatment of a planting field: planting trees distributed in rows in advance on a planting field, and paving a planting matrix between adjacent rows of trees, wherein the planting matrix mainly comprises sandstone and sawdust; s-4, planting the dendrobium seedlings: arranging planting holes on the planting substrate, and planting the dendrobium seedlings in the planting holes together with the domestication substrate; and S-5, managing and harvesting the dendrobium. According to the invention, domestication is carried out before planting of the dendrobium seedlings, so that the survival rate of the dendrobium seedlings is improved, and the survival rate can be improved by at least 5%. Not only can the quality of the dendrobium be ensured, but also the polysaccharide content of the obtained dendrobium officinale can reach more than 32%, and the economic benefit is obviously improved.

Background
Dendrobe is a common and famous traditional Chinese medicinal material in China, and has a long application history, the traditional Chinese medicine considers that dendrobe has the effects of nourishing yin, promoting the secretion of saliva or body fluid, tonifying spleen, nourishing stomach, protecting liver, benefiting gallbladder, clearing mulberry, improving eyesight, reducing blood sugar, inhibiting tumor, enhancing immunity, relieving fatigue, moistening skin and prolonging life, and people in the past advocate dendrobe, and records and lists in medical classics in the past. Modern medical research shows that: the herba Dendrobii contains various essential microelements, polysaccharide, alkaloid, amino acids, etc., and has effects of improving immunity, inhibiting thrombosis, inhibiting tumor and delaying aging.
The existing dendrobium officinale cultivation method is continuously improved, the cultivation mode is developed into a three-dimensional cultivation mode from single greenhouse cultivation, and the novel dendrobium officinale cultivation method is continuously promoted. The greenhouse cultivation is convenient, the water and fertilizer conditions are good, but diseases, insects, rats and grasses have great harm and general quality, and roots are easy to rot due to improper management, so that the yield is reduced. The tree-bound cultivation is characterized by difficult root rot, poor water retention and fertilizer retention, less harm of diseases, insects, rats and grasses, better quality, slower lumber production time and less yield.
At present, there are some wild-imitating seed methods, for example, a wild-imitating ecological planting method of dendrobium officinale disclosed in 24.12.2019 with publication No. CN110604049A, mountain landform areas are selected, dendrobium officinale plants are put into gaps between stones or roots are nailed into the stones, the ecological environment of wild dendrobium officinale is almost completely simulated for planting, and the polysaccharide content of the obtained dendrobium officinale can reach 29.8%. However, the planting method has low survival rate, low economic benefit and high requirement on the terrain, and cannot popularize the planting. At present, an effective planting method which can ensure not only the variety of the dendrobium but also the survival rate is unavailable.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to provide a wild-imitating planting method for dendrobium officinale, which can ensure the quality of the dendrobium officinale, ensure that the polysaccharide content of the obtained dendrobium officinale can reach more than 32 percent, ensure the survival rate of the dendrobium officinale and obviously improve the economic benefit.
The invention adopts the following technical scheme:
a wild-imitating planting method of dendrobium officinale comprises the following steps:
s-1, obtaining dendrobium seedlings: selecting stem sections with internodes of Dendrobium officinale, and obtaining Dendrobium seedlings by adopting a tissue culture method;
s-2, domestication of dendrobium seedlings: removing the dendrobium seedlings from the tissue culture medium, cleaning the culture medium, planting the dendrobium seedlings in a domestication substrate, domesticating for 12-15 days under domestication conditions, wherein the domestication conditions are that 10 hours are at 25-30 ℃ and 4 hours are at 42-45 ℃ as a cycle;
s-3, treatment of a planting field: planting trees distributed in rows in advance on a planting field, and paving a planting matrix between adjacent rows of trees, wherein the planting matrix mainly comprises sandstone and sawdust;
s-4, planting the dendrobium seedlings: arranging planting holes on the planting substrate, and planting the dendrobium seedlings in the planting holes together with the domestication substrate;
and S-5, managing and harvesting the dendrobium.
According to the technical scheme, the domestication is carried out before the dendrobium seedlings are planted, so that the survival rate of the dendrobium seedlings is improved, and the survival rate can be improved by at least 5%. The dendrobium officinale contains rich dendrobium active polysaccharide, and the content of the polysaccharide in the wild dendrobium officinale is 25% or more at present. The herba Dendrobii active polysaccharide has effects of resisting tumor, relieving inflammation, lowering blood pressure, lowering blood sugar, inhibiting lipid peroxidation, resisting aging, promoting health recovery, increasing leukocyte, assisting cancer treatment, and improving immunity. In the prior art, the content of the dendrobe active polysaccharide can only be increased to 29 percent at most, and the content of the dendrobe active polysaccharide can reach more than 32 percent by the technical scheme of the invention through special domestication treatment and treatment on a planting field.
Among the above-mentioned technical scheme, use the mode of imitative wild, the quality of stem of noble dendrobium more is close wild, need not select special region moreover, does benefit to the popularization planting of stem of noble dendrobium.
Preferably, a planting platform is stacked between adjacent rows of arbors, and the planting matrix is laid on the planting platform.
Preferably, the planting substrate comprises sand, sawdust and pine needles. Sawdust is used as a relatively ideal culture medium, when the dendrobium is used alone, rotten roots and growth stagnation easily occur in the later period, the situation of rotten roots can be overcome to a certain extent after sand and stones are added, but the growth speed of the dendrobium is influenced, the dendrobium grows slowly, the yield is low, even the dendrobium dies, and particularly under the situation that the dendrobium can be harvested by a wild-like planting method for about two to three years, the subsequent sawdust needs to be added, so that the normal growth of the dendrobium can be maintained. In the scheme, on the basis of the sandstone and the sawdust, pine needles are added,
preferably, the sand comprises a first sand having a particle size of between 1 and 3 cm and a second sand having a particle size of between 0.1 and 0.3 cm. The second sand stone with small particle size is dispersed among the sawdust to maintain the fluffy state of the sawdust without hardening, thereby ensuring the effects of the sand stone and the pine needles.
Preferably, the adding amount of the first sand and stone is related to the adding amount of the pine needles, and 0.2-0.5kg of the first sand and stone is preferably added to each kg of the pine needles.
Preferably, the amount of the second sand is related to the amount of the sawdust, and preferably 0.8-1.2kg of the second sand is added per kg of sawdust.
Preferably, a coal cinder layer below the planting substrate is laid on the planting platform.
Preferably, the height of the cinder layer is at least 5 cm.
Preferably, the distance between the planting platform and the arbor is not more than 20 centimeters.
Preferably, the height of the planting platform is 40-50 cm.
Preferably, a shelter is built between adjacent rows of trees.
Preferably, the planting holes are 2-3 cm deep.
Preferably, the dendrobium seedlings are planted in spring or autumn, and particularly, the dendrobium seedlings are preferably planted in spring rather than in autumn. The method mainly makes full use of the conditions of spring March, climate rising, wind and warm day, spring rain such as oil, gold season for recovering everything, proper temperature and humidity, sunshine, rainwater and the like, is favorable for stimulating the axillary buds at the stem base of the dendrobium to rapidly germinate, and simultaneously grows aerial roots for the buds to absorb nutrients and moisture, thereby achieving the purpose of growing the first roots and the second roots. The autumn planting is to use the proper temperature in autumn (proper before spring in light sun) to initiate the growth of root system, but the quality, quantity and growth speed of the root are not as good as those in spring. In the place with good shading condition and meeting the humid condition, a part of very small sprouts can grow in summer. After various preparation works before planting are completed, the best planting season can be selected to rapidly develop the dendrobium production.
Through the implementation of the technical scheme, the invention has the following technical effects: through domestication before the dendrobium seedlings are planted, the survival rate of the dendrobium seedlings is improved, and the survival rate can be improved by at least 5%. Not only can the quality of the dendrobium be ensured, but also the polysaccharide content of the obtained dendrobium officinale can reach more than 32%, and the economic benefit is obviously improved.
Detailed Description
The present invention will be described in further detail with reference to specific embodiments. It is to be understood that the embodiments of the present invention are merely for illustrating the present invention and not for limiting the present invention, and that various substitutions and alterations made according to the common knowledge and conventional means in the art without departing from the technical idea of the present invention are included in the scope of the present invention.
Example 1
A wild-imitating planting method of dendrobium officinale comprises the following steps:
s-1, obtaining dendrobium seedlings: selecting a stem section with internodes of the dendrobium officinale, and obtaining dendrobium seedlings by adopting the conventional tissue culture method;
s-2, domestication of dendrobium seedlings: removing the dendrobium seedlings from the tissue culture medium, cleaning the culture medium, planting the dendrobium seedlings in a domestication substrate, domesticating for 12-15 days under domestication conditions, wherein the domestication conditions are a period of 10 hours at 30 ℃ and 4 hours at 42 ℃;
s-3, treatment of a planting field: according to the planting scale, a planting field is selected, trees (trees can be tung tree, green-wood, cinnamomum camphora, nanmu and the like) which are distributed in rows are planted on the planting field 2-3 years in advance, a shade is erected between the trees, two rows of planting platforms are stacked between adjacent rows of trees, the distance between each planting platform and each tree is not more than 20 cm, the height of each planting platform is 40-50 cm, planting matrixes are laid on the planting platforms, and the planting matrixes are planted according to the mass ratio of 1: 1 mixing sandstone and sawdust;
s-4, planting the dendrobium seedlings: in autumn, in 8-9 months, planting holes with a depth of 2-3 cm are formed in the planting substrate, and the dendrobium seedlings are planted in the planting holes together with the domestication substrate;
and S-5, managing and harvesting the dendrobium, wherein the management comprises conventional water and fertilizer management and weeding management, and the dendrobium is harvested in about 3 years.
The content of polysaccharide in the obtained dendrobium officinale is 32.1%. The survival rate of the dendrobium seedlings is 82%.
Example 2:
a wild-imitating planting method of dendrobium officinale comprises the following steps:
s-1, obtaining dendrobium seedlings: selecting a stem section with internodes of the dendrobium officinale, cutting the stem section into 0.5-1 cm serving as an explant after conventional disinfection, adopting MS and B5 as basic culture media, and respectively adding a plurality of culture media of different hormone combinations such as plant hormones NAA (0.05-1.5 mg/L), IAA (0.2-1.0 mg/L), 6-BA (1.0-5.0 mg/L) and the like, wherein the pH of the culture media is 5.6-6.0, the culture temperature is 25-28 ℃, the illumination is 9-10 hours per day, and the tissue culture is carried out under the condition of the illumination intensity of 1800-1900 lx. After 19 days, the stem leaves have small bud points, after about 1 month, the small buds are elongated and have bifurcated tips, and after 2 months, the small buds grow into dendrobium seedlings with the height of about 2.0-2.7 cm and 4-8 leaves;
s-2, domestication of dendrobium seedlings: removing the dendrobium seedlings from the tissue culture medium, cleaning the culture medium, planting the dendrobium seedlings in a domestication substrate, domesticating for 12-15 days under domestication conditions, wherein the domestication conditions are a cycle of 10 hours at 28 ℃ and 4 hours at 45 ℃;
s-3, treatment of a planting field: according to the planting scale, a planting field is selected, trees distributed in rows are planted on the planting field 2-3 years in advance, a shade is erected between the trees, two rows of planting platforms are stacked between adjacent rows of trees, the distance between each planting platform and each tree is not more than 20 cm, the height of each planting platform is 40-45 cm, planting matrixes are laid on the planting platforms, and the planting matrixes are planted on the planting platforms in a mass ratio of 1: 1 mixing sandstone and sawdust;
s-4, planting the dendrobium seedlings: in spring for 3-4 months, planting holes with depth of 2-3 cm are formed on the planting substrate, and the dendrobium seedlings are planted in the planting holes together with the domestication substrate;
and S-5, managing and harvesting the dendrobium, wherein the management comprises conventional water and fertilizer management and weeding management, and the dendrobium is harvested in about 3 years.
The content of polysaccharide in the obtained dendrobium officinale is 32.6%. The survival rate of the dendrobium seedlings is 81 percent.
Example 3
A wild-imitating planting method of dendrobium officinale comprises the following steps:
s-1, obtaining dendrobium seedlings: selecting a stem section with internodes of the dendrobium officinale, cutting the stem section into 0.5-1 cm serving as an explant after conventional disinfection, adopting MS and B5 as basic culture media, and respectively adding a plurality of culture media of different hormone combinations such as plant hormones NAA (0.05-1.5 mg/L), IAA (0.2-1.0 mg/L), 6-BA (1.0-5.0 mg/L) and the like, wherein the pH of the culture media is 5.6-6.0, the culture temperature is 25-28 ℃, the illumination is 9-10 hours per day, and the tissue culture is carried out under the condition of the illumination intensity of 1800-1900 lx. After 19 days, the stem leaves have small bud points, after about 1 month, the small buds are elongated and have bifurcated tips, and after 2 months, the small buds grow into dendrobium seedlings with the height of about 2.0-2.7 cm and 4-8 leaves;
s-2, domestication of dendrobium seedlings: removing the dendrobium seedlings from the tissue culture medium, cleaning the culture medium, planting the dendrobium seedlings in a domestication substrate, domesticating for 12-15 days under domestication conditions, wherein the domestication conditions are a cycle of 10 hours at 25 ℃ and 4 hours at 43 ℃;
s-3, treatment of a planting field: according to the planting scale, a planting field is selected, trees distributed in rows are planted on the planting field 2-3 years in advance, a shade shed is erected between the trees, two rows of planting platforms are stacked between adjacent rows of trees, the distance between each planting platform and each tree is not more than 20 cm, the height of each planting platform is 45-50 cm, a cinder layer and a planting matrix are sequentially paved on each planting platform, the height of each cinder layer is 5-8 cm, and the planting matrix is prepared by the following steps of: 1 mixing sandstone and sawdust;
s-4, planting the dendrobium seedlings: in spring for 3-4 months, planting holes with depth of 2-3 cm are formed on the planting substrate, and the dendrobium seedlings are planted in the planting holes together with the domestication substrate;
and S-5, managing and harvesting the dendrobium, wherein the management comprises conventional water and fertilizer management and weeding management, and the dendrobium is harvested in about 3 years.
The content of polysaccharide in the obtained dendrobium officinale is 32.8%. The survival rate of the dendrobium seedlings is 83 percent.
Example 4
The difference from the embodiment 3 is that the planting substrate comprises sand, sawdust and pine needles, wherein the particle size of the sand is between 1 and 3 centimeters.
The content of polysaccharide in the obtained dendrobium officinale is 33.2%. The survival rate of the dendrobium seedlings is 88 percent.
Example 5
The difference from the embodiment 3 is that the planting substrate comprises sand, sawdust and pine needles, wherein the particle size of the sand is between 0.1 and 0.3 cm.
The content of polysaccharide in the obtained dendrobium officinale is 32.8%. The survival rate of the dendrobium seedlings is 84 percent.
Example 6
The difference from the embodiment 3 is that the planting substrate comprises sand, sawdust and pine needles, wherein the sand comprises first sand with the grain diameter of 1-3 cm and second sand with the grain diameter of 0.1-0.3 cm. The second sand stone with small particle size is dispersed among the sawdust to maintain the fluffy state of the sawdust without hardening, thereby ensuring the effects of the sand stone and the pine needles. The adding amount of the first sand stone is related to the adding amount of the pine needles, and 0.3kg of the first sand stone is preferably added to each kg of the pine needles. The amount of the second sand added is related to the amount of the sawdust, and preferably 0.8kg of the second sand is added per kg of the sawdust.
The content of polysaccharide in the obtained dendrobium officinale is 33.5%. The survival rate of the dendrobium seedlings is 93 percent.
Example 7
The difference from example 6 is that 0.5kg of first sand is added per kg of pine needles. 1.2kg of second sand is added per kg of sawdust.
The content of polysaccharide in the obtained dendrobium officinale is 32.9%. The survival rate of the dendrobium seedlings is 94 percent.
Comparative example 1
The difference from example 1 is that, S-2. the domestication method of dendrobe seedlings adopts the existing method disclosed in, for example, CN 110604049A: and (5) placing the cultured seedlings in a greenhouse for culturing for 6-10 months. The content of polysaccharide in the dendrobium officinale is 28.6%. The survival rate of the dendrobium seedlings is 67 percent.
The polysaccharide content determination method for the dendrobium officinale planted in each example and comparative example adopts the following steps: grand grandma, Liu Yuan, Li Xiao Yun, Liu super, "determination of polysaccharide content in different species and different medicinal parts of Dendrobium nobile".
The survival rate of the dendrobium officinale planted in each example and comparative example is x100% of the number of cultivated plants/the number of plants at harvest.
